Exlservice Holdings Inc
Glance View
ExlService Holdings is a business services company that helps large organizations run parts of their operations more efficiently. It handles work like customer service, claims processing, finance and accounting support, and data and analytics services. Its main customers are companies in insurance, healthcare, banking, financial services, and other industries that want to outsource repetitive or data-heavy work. The company makes money by charging contract fees for those services, usually under long-term agreements. It often acts as an outside operations partner, taking over specific business processes and using software, data tools, and trained staff to do the work. In many cases, the value comes from helping clients lower costs, improve speed, and make better decisions from their data. What makes EXL different is that it sits between traditional outsourcing and modern data analytics. It does not just move paperwork or call-center work offshore; it also builds analytics and automation into those services. That mix lets it support both everyday operations and higher-value work like forecasting, risk analysis, and process improvement.
